Business blogging is a good way to achieve “accidental rankings” (those you didn’t necessarily plan for) and discover more search-driven sales channels. And yet, many business owners or marketing managers have no idea what their blogs are ranking for. Consequently, there’s no buying journey set up for anyone who lands on a blog post. Clicks may come, but a blog remains an island. So, how can you include your blog in your overall marketing strategy?
